What is TypeScript & Why Does it Matter?
TypeScript is a strongly typed, open-source programming language built on top of JavaScript created by Microsoft. It adds static type definitions to detect errors early during compilation.
Why It's Critical: It catches up to 15% of common developer runtime bugs before code is even deployed, provides rich IDE autocomplete, and makes large team code refactoring safe and painless.

Key Features of TypeScript
Explore the architectural features that make TypeScript a preferred choice for enterprise digital solutions.
Static Type Checking
Detects syntax, type mismatch, and null reference errors at build time rather than runtime.
Rich IDE Tooling & Autocomplete
Provides instant inline code navigation, documentation, and smart refactoring tools.
Interfaces & Type Definitions
Defines explicit data contracts for API payloads, database models, and props.
Generics & Advanced Types
Builds flexible, highly reusable code abstractions with strict type guarantees.
ESNext Feature Support
Compiles modern JavaScript features down to target browser versions safely.
Full JavaScript Interop
Gradually adoptable in any existing JS codebase with zero runtime performance penalty.
